Scala set去重与case class_scala case class list 去重-CSDN博客

网站介绍:文章浏览阅读862次。set去重:底层使用了hashMap进行去重,而hashMap判定元素是否相同时调用了hashcode,equals方法。若在使用过程中使用set来装自定义类型并且想要达到去重的目的需要实现hashcode,equals方法在使用中发现若用set装自定义的case class会自动实现去重,代码如下:case class Name(name:String) def main(ar..._scala case class list 去重